Registration for the 2022 BRI Christmas Parade is now open

BEDFORD – Registration for the 2022 Bedford Revitalization, Inc. Christmas Parade is now open and set to return on Saturday, December 3rd.

The theme is a general “Christmas” theme to allow parade entries to focus mostly on the Christmas light aspect of their parade entry. ALL ENTRIES MUST HAVE CHRISTMAS LIGHTS incorporated into their design, as this is an illuminated Christmas Parade. It is free to have an entry in the parade.

This year’s Grand Marshals will be the Winnefeld Family who started the Batcole Foundation in 2015 in honor of their son and brother, Cole.

The Batcole Foundation is a public 501(c)3 non-profit, that is committed to raising funds for research to develop novel, superior therapies for neuroblastoma and other pediatric cancers. When Cole was initially diagnosed, and throughout his treatment, he always loved all things superheroes, especially Batman. The Batcole symbol was drawn on a napkin by a family friend and quickly became Cole’s identity.

Together with their foundation board, specialized pediatric cancer treatment centers, and physicians, their goal is to identify clinical therapies which have the most promising clinical blueprints for success. The Batcole Foundation also assists Indiana families in treatment for kids’ cancer by providing gift cards, toys, and financial assistance to ease their burdens.
